Amerileagues
Amerileagues was founded in 2013 to establish the Cincinnati Premier Youth Basketball League to fill a need in the Greater Cincinnati area for a more transparent, efficient, and communicative partner for community basketball organizations. In 4 short years, the CPYBL has grown from a membership of 170 teams to over 1300 teams incorporating both recreational and athletic teams from the southwest Ohio area. In 2015, the newly formed Greater Cincinnati Catholic Youth Sports organization awarded Amerileagues a three-year contract to run their boys and girls youth basketball and volleyball leagues includes league and tournament scheduling, referee assignment, web site and communication, and incident management. We were recently awarded with a five year extension. After establishing the first community volleyball league in Cincinnati (Cincinnati Premier Youth Volleyball League) in 2016, Amerileagues is looking to expand in the Dayton and Columbus markets in Ohio, as well as other regional markets in the Midwest.
